I remember about 5 years ago my Sony XA-777ES had problems with reading some SACD's. I cleaned the laser with Isopropyl alcohol and it helped. No problems since.
Same thing happened with my Sony B/R. It was driving me crazy with the message 'cant read the disc'. I cleaned the laser and problem was solved.

Cleaning a laser lens works if the lens is dirty and that's what causing the issue. Cleaning the lens of a faulty laser won't fix anything, although the lens might be clean.
